High-density racking systems require careful engineering. Standard shelving is only designed for basic vertical loads, but heavy-duty systems must withstand complex dynamic stresses. These forces include forklift impacts, seismic events, asymmetrical pallet placement, and high-frequency pallet movements.
Before steel coils are cut and punched, Durack’s team of 65 engineers uses advanced Finite Element Analysis (FEA). This software models stress, strain, and displacement across the entire racking frame. By simulating loads up to 2.5 times the rated capacity, we identify potential stress concentration points. This helps us optimize structural strength without adding unnecessary steel weight. Our physical quality assurance also includes testing the ultimate tensile strength of weld seams and running dynamic load tests on key support beams.
We source certified structural steel (grades Q235B and Q355B) to ensure uniform yield strength and reliable welding performance. Durack’s roll-forming mills produce specialized column profiles with multi-bend configurations. These unique shapes improve load capacity and resist twisting forces. In addition, our locking connector pins and heavy-duty floor baseplates are zinc-plated to resist wear and prevent mechanical failure under pressure.
Our multi-stage pre-treatment process includes acid-washing and Parkerising. This removes mill scale and creates a phosphate conversion coating for excellent paint adhesion.
Robotic welding systems apply consistent MIG welds to beam connectors. This eliminates human error and guarantees complete weld penetration.
QC technicians use digital calipers and ultrasonic thickness testers to confirm every batch matches the exact technical drawings.
Global procurement teams often source racking and logistics systems from Chinese manufacturers because of the country’s strong supply chain efficiency. China is the world's largest steel producer, which ensures a steady supply of raw materials and reduces cost fluctuations. The Pearl River Delta, where Dongguan Durack is located, provides convenient access to local steel processing plants, specialized hardware suppliers, and advanced powder coating manufacturers.
This geographic cluster helps us reduce raw material lead times to just 3 to 5 days, compared to weeks in other regions. In addition, our proximity to major international ports like Shenzhen and Guangzhou makes global shipping and container logistics efficient and cost-effective. By combining automated production with local raw material sourcing, Chinese exporters can offer high-quality structural racking systems at very competitive prices.
